The amount of sunshine is fundamental to comprehending a place's climate. This page shows the total number of hours of direct sunlight per month and the average hours per day in Kokpekty, Kazakhstan. The figures are based on a 30-year period (1990–2020) to provide a reliable average.
Sunshine in Kokpekty varies greatly throughout the year. The sunniest month, July, reaches an impressive 341 hours, while December, the darkest month, offers only 102 hours. The total annual amount of sun is 2664 hours.
This means the city can be enjoyed more throughout the sunniest month of July under a blue sky, with approximately 11.4 hours of sunshine daily. In contrast, the city experiences much darker days in December, with only 3.4 hours of sunlight per day.
Kokpekty enjoys an average of 2664 hours of sunshine annually. Let’s compare this with some popular tourist destinations:
Seville, Spain, enjoys an impressive 2920 hours of sunshine per year, making it an ideal destination even in winter.
Manchester, UK, experiences just around 1420 hours of sunshine annually.
Boston, USA, enjoys 2629 hours of sunshine annually, with distinct seasons and many bright, sunny days.
Melbourne, Australia, has 2380 hours of sunshine annually, with its famous “four seasons in a day” weather pattern.
November, Kokpekty’s wettest month, receives 40 mm (1.6 in) of snowfall and has a maximum daytime temperature of 1°C (34°F). During the driest month September you can expect a temperature of 22°C (72°F).
